Ammonia enters the expansion valve of a refrigeration system at a pressure of 10 bar and a temperature of 18°C and exits at 2.0 bar. The refrigerant undergoes a throttling process. Determine the temperature. in “C, and the quality of the refrigerant at the exit ofthe expansion valve.
